Web"Photograph" is a song by English singer-songwriter Ed Sheeran from his second studio album, × (2014). Sheeran wrote the song with Snow Patrol member Johnny McDaid, who had a piano loop from which the composition developed. WebDec 27, 2009 · Copy. Answer Photograph is a song written by Ringo Starr and George Harrison. It was released by Ringo Starr as a single in October1973, reaching number eight and number one in the UK and U.S. singles charts, respectively. There is also a Def Leppard track called Photograph.
